Understanding Portable Hipot Testers
A portable hipot tester is designed to apply high voltage to electrical apparatuses to check for insulation integrity and ensure that components are safe for use. These testers are essential tools for anyone involved in product safety verification, as they help locate potential weaknesses in an electrical system that could lead to failures or hazards.
Key Features of Portable Hipot Testers
Portable hipot testers come equipped with several features that enhance their usability and effectiveness:
- High Voltage Output: Most devices can generate high voltages ranging from 1000V to over 5000V, allowing for a wide range of testing options.
- Compact and Lightweight: Designed for portability, these testers are lightweight and easy to carry, making them suitable for field and on-site testing.
- User-Friendly Interface: Many models include digital displays and intuitive controls, making them accessible even for less experienced operators.

While using a portable hipot tester, safety should always be a priority. Here are some recommended practices:
- Ensure the tester is calibrated correctly before use.
- Follow the manufacturer’s guidelines for connecting the tester to the device being evaluated.
- W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) during testing.
